Other: Nitrogen - containing groups can stabilize metal atoms and form strong coordination bonds.
Applications
1) Used for one - pot tandem reductive amination of aldehydes to prepare secondary imines.
2) Can catalyze the reaction of a variety of substituted aromatic aldehyde compounds to form corresponding secondary imines.
